    La Fontaine Memory Care in Frisco, TX is an exceptional assisted living community that specializes in providing respite care for individuals with memory care needs. Our community offers a range of amenities and services to ensure the comfort, well-being, and independence of our residents.

    Our fully furnished accommodations are designed with the needs of memory care residents in mind. Each room features cable or satellite TV for entertainment, as well as a kitchenette for convenience. Housekeeping services are provided to maintain cleanliness and order.

    Residents can enjoy the beautiful outdoor space and garden area, perfect for relaxation and socializing with fellow residents. Our restaurant-style dining room serves delicious meals prepared by our skilled staff who accommodate special dietary restrictions such as a diabetes diet.

    We provide 24-hour supervision to ensure the safety and security of our residents. Our compassionate staff is trained to assist with activities of daily living, including bathing, dressing, and transfers. Medication management is offered to guarantee proper administration of medications.

    At La Fontaine Memory Care, we prioritize mental wellness through our specialized program. Residents can participate in resident-run activities and scheduled daily activities that promote engagement and socialization within the community.

    Our location offers easy access to various amenities nearby. There are four cafes, parks and restaurants within close proximity to our community. Additionally, there are several pharmacies, physicians' offices, places of worship, and a hospital nearby for convenient healthcare access.

    Whether for short-term respite care or long-term memory care needs, La Fontaine Memory Care provides exceptional support and quality living for individuals requiring specialized assistance.

    This area of Frisco, Texas offers a variety of amenities that cater to the needs and interests of seniors. With multiple hospitals in close proximity such as Baylor Scott & White Medical Center and Texas Health Presbyterian Hospital Plano, residents have access to quality healthcare services. There are also several cafes, pharmacies, and physicians' offices nearby for convenience. For leisure activities, there are parks like Twin Creeks Park and Hoblitzelle Park where seniors can enjoy nature and outdoor activities. The presence of places of worship such as Hope Fellowship and St Francis Catholic Church provide spiritual support. Additionally, there are options for dining out at restaurants like Chuy's and Fuzzy's Taco Shop, as well as entertainment at theaters like Cinemark. Overall, this part of Frisco offers a well-rounded community with amenities that can enhance the quality of life for seniors.

      Medicare does not cover assisted living costs, as it focuses on acute medical needs and short-term care, with exceptions for certain medically necessary services like physical therapy. Individuals must explore other options such as Medicaid, veterans' benefits, or long-term care insurance to manage these expenses effectively.
